Job Summary
Conduct comprehensive patient assessments to develop individualized hospice care plans and coordinate interdisciplinary team meetings to review and update patient goals. Monitor patient conditions regularly, adjust care plans as necessary, and provide education and support regarding disease progression and symptom management. Serve as the primary point of contact for patients, families, and healthcare providers to facilitate communication, ensure compliance with regulations, and advocate for patient rights and preferences. Manage multiple cases while maintaining accurate documentation and collaborating with community resources to enhance support. This full-time role at Blue Summit Hospice and Palliative Care in Snellville focuses on delivering compassionate, patient-centered end-of-life care to individuals facing life-limiting illnesses.
Required Qualifications
- Current and valid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of Georgia
- Minimum of two years of clinical nursing experience
- Strong knowledge of hospice care principles, symptom management, and end-of-life care practices
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to manage multiple cases simultaneously while maintaining attention to detail and documentation accuracy
Desired Qualifications
- Certification in Hospice and Palliative Nursing (CHPN) or equivalent specialty certification
- Experience with electronic medical records (EMR) systems and hospice-specific documentation software
- Background in case management or care coordination within a hospice or home health setting
- Familiarity with Medicare hospice regulations and reimbursement processes
- Demonstrated skills in patient and family education, grief counseling, and cultural competency
